Common questions

How many calories are in Bio-bircher-müsli?

Bio-bircher-müsli by Spar NaturPur has 354 kcal per 100 g.

How much protein is in Bio-bircher-müsli?

Bio-bircher-müsli contains 10 g of protein per 100 g.

Is Bio-bircher-müsli a good source of protein?

Yes — 10 g of protein per 100 g, supplying 12% of its calories. That makes it a good protein source.

Is Bio-bircher-müsli high in carbs?

Yes — carbohydrates provide 73% of its calories (61 g per 100 g, of which 15 g is sugar). It also delivers 8.9 g of fiber.

Is Bio-bircher-müsli high in sugar?

Yes — 15 g of sugar per 100 g, roughly 4 teaspoons. Sugar makes up 25% of its carbohydrates.

Is Bio-bircher-müsli low in sodium?

Yes — just 44 mg per 100 g (2% of the daily value), which qualifies as low sodium.

Is Bio-bircher-müsli a good source of fiber?

It provides 8.9 g of fiber per 100 g — 32% of the daily value, making it a high-fiber food.

Why does Bio-bircher-müsli have a Nutri-Score of A?

Nutri-Score weighs negatives (calories, sugar, saturated fat, sodium) against positives (fiber, protein) per 100 g. Points against come from calorie density (354 kcal), sugar (15 g); points in favor come from fiber (8.9 g), protein (10 g). Overall that places it in band A.
